A useful Football Tickets and Events website is not simply a collection of attractive football sections. It must serve supporters, season-ticket holders, hospitality buyers and event visitors and move buyers from fixture selection to a valid ticket with minimal uncertainty. The planning decisions below create a clearer visitor journey and give editors a structure they can maintain after launch.
Plan around the visitor’s real task
The homepage should identify the highest-priority action for the current period, such as the next match, registration window, ticket release or campaign. Navigation labels should use language visitors already understand. Time-sensitive information needs a visible date or status so people can distinguish confirmed updates from evergreen guidance.
Essential pages for a Football Tickets and Events
- Fixture and event listing
- Seating, pricing and availability
- Account, membership and eligibility rules
- Mobile ticket and stadium-entry help
- Refund, transfer and accessibility information
Each page should have a named content owner, a review schedule and links to the next useful action. Related information should be connected instead of copied into several places; this reduces contradictions and helps search engines understand the relationship between teams, fixtures, people, products and policies.
Connect football operations to publishing
Ticket availability, membership windows and venue sections must update from the ticketing system. Never display a marketing price that differs from checkout.
Improve conversion and trust
Show total price, eligibility, seat information and delivery method before payment. Queue, timeout and sold-out states need clear next steps. Use accurate names, dates, prices and contact details, and remove every demonstration placeholder before launch.
Mobile performance and search visibility
The entire purchase and mobile-ticket retrieval journey must work on a phone under matchday network pressure. Use one descriptive H1, concise page titles, unique summaries, meaningful image alt text and internal links. Set explicit image dimensions, lazy-load content below the fold and avoid loading builder assets on pages that do not use them.
